【dedeCMS5.7织梦系统tag完美标签静态】在使用dedeCMS 5.7织梦系统的过程中,用户常常会遇到关于“tag标签”的问题。虽然系统本身支持tag功能,但默认情况下,tag标签的链接是动态形式(如`/tags.php?/xxx`),不利于搜索引擎优化(SEO)和用户体验。为了提升网站的整体性能与可访问性,很多用户选择将tag标签进行静态化处理。
通过合理的设置和代码调整,可以实现tag标签的静态化,使URL更简洁、友好,并提高网站的搜索排名。以下是针对dedeCMS 5.7中tag标签静态化的总结及操作方式。
一、tag标签静态化的作用
功能 | 说明 |
提升SEO | 静态URL更利于搜索引擎抓取和索引 |
增强用户体验 | 简洁的URL更易记忆和分享 |
提高网站速度 | 静态页面加载更快,减少服务器压力 |
支持伪静态 | 可结合Apache或Nginx实现伪静态访问 |
二、实现tag标签静态化的方法
步骤 | 操作说明 | |
1 | 修改配置文件 | 在`/include/common.inc.php`中添加`$cfg_tag_url = 'tags';`,设置tag的静态路径 |
2 | 修改模板文件 | 在`/templets/default/list_tag.htm`中修改调用方式为`{dede:tag}` |
3 | 设置伪静态规则 | 根据服务器类型(Apache/Nginx)配置对应的伪静态规则,如`RewriteRule ^tags/(.).html$ /tags.php?/ $1` |
4 | 测试并更新 | 生成HTML后测试tag页面是否正常显示,确保静态化成功 |
三、注意事项
事项 | 说明 |
备份数据 | 修改前建议备份数据库和文件 |
检查权限 | 确保静态文件目录有写入权限 |
清除缓存 | 修改后清除系统缓存和浏览器缓存 |
版本兼容 | 确保操作适用于dedeCMS 5.7版本,避免与其他插件冲突 |
四、总结
dedeCMS 5.7织梦系统通过合理配置,可以实现tag标签的静态化处理,从而提升网站的SEO效果和用户体验。操作过程中需要注意配置文件修改、伪静态规则设置以及测试验证等关键步骤。对于有一定技术基础的用户来说,这一过程相对简单且效果显著。
通过静态化tag标签,不仅可以让网站内容更加规范,还能有效提升搜索引擎的抓取效率,为网站带来更多的自然流量。